Photography Basics
# ISO
- The sensitivity of the camera's sensor
- Keep the ISO as low as possible
- The higher the ISO, will the more grain and more noise
- Under light (100) Under shades (200) Indoor (400)
# Aperture
- The size of the opening of the lens
- The lower the number, the more light gets in
- Controls the depth of field
# Shutter speed
- Slower shutter speed = More motion blur
